Google Cloud teams work with schools, companies, and government agencies to make them more productive, mobile, and collaborative. On this team, you will drive Google Cloud business relationships by analyzing partner business performance, identifying methods of increasing partner and Google returns, pitching ideas to and identifying opportunities within partners, and coordinating across Google teams to deliver.
As a Partner Sales Manager, you'll be responsible to partner with the relevant Sales team to cultivate opportunities with our Google partners. You will be the point of contact for the team to drive partner activity. In addition to working with the Google Sales team, you will also work closely with other Sales teams from Google’s ecosystem of partners, and you will manage the day-to-day interaction between the two. You will build the partner strategy for an aligned Sales region, orchestrate the engagement with partners, work cross-functionally to integrate resellers, system integrators (SIs), managed service providers (MSPs), global system integrators (GSIs), or independent software vendors (ISVs) into the process, and advocate for Channel Programs to influence the evolution of future opportunities for the channel.

Collaborate with internal teams, including Sales and Partner Management teams, to discuss and establish the joint business plan with the partner.
Identify the right Google partner for each opportunity from the portfolio of partners managed by Google and suggest opportunities for partner sourced agreements.
Lead Monthly Business Reviews (MBRs), Quarterly Business Reviews (QBRs), and pipeline and forecast management.
Report on all partner activity and work closely with Sales and Partner Management teams to optimize and ensure alignment.
Set the partner roadmap for the Sales team and identify which partners are industry or workload aligned to drive demand generation activities with partners, through events and campaigns through an industry focused plan in coordination with Partner Marketing.
